Schengen visa insurance
A Schengen insurance is a medical travel insurance that meets the requirements of the EU for obtaining a visa. In 2004, the European Union decided to introduce an obligation for medical travel insurance as a condition for issuing a Short Stay Visa that foreign nationals can apply for to visit the Netherlands.
Schengen visa health insurance
To apply for a Schengen visa for the Netherlands, you must have medical travel insurance or health insurance. This insurance reimburses medical costs that you incur in the Schengen area. View the insurance requirements.
